What is the Subcontractor Vendor Pre-Qualification Form?
The Subcontractor Vendor Pre-Qualification Form serves as a critical tool for evaluating and pre-qualifying subcontractors within the construction industry. This document plays a vital role by collecting essential information such as company contact details, trade experience, insurance coverage, and project history. By effectively gathering this data, the form ensures that only qualified subcontractors are considered for various projects, thereby contributing to successful project outcomes.
This form not only streamlines the subcontractor evaluation process but also establishes a standardized method for assessing vendors, significantly improving project management efficiencies.
Purpose and Benefits of the Subcontractor Vendor Pre-Qualification Form
Companies utilize the Subcontractor Vendor Pre-Qualification Form primarily to mitigate risks and enhance the quality of work delivered on construction projects. Pre-qualifying subcontractors before hiring helps ensure that only experienced and reliable vendors are selected. This proactive approach significantly contributes to project efficiency and overall success.
Benefits of using this evaluation form include reducing potential project delays, decreasing financial risks, and fostering clearer communication between contractors and subcontractors.
Who Needs the Subcontractor Vendor Pre-Qualification Form?
The Subcontractor Vendor Pre-Qualification Form is essential for various stakeholders in the construction sector. General contractors, project managers, and firms that hire subcontractors significantly benefit from implementing this form.
Subcontractors who seek to be included in a contractor's vendor list must complete the form to fulfill vendor qualification requirements. Industries such as construction and engineering routinely rely on this document to simplify their vendor evaluation processes.

Who is eligible to use the Subcontractor Vendor Pre-Qualification Form?
Any subcontractor or vendor seeking to work on projects with companies in the construction industry can use this form to demonstrate their qualifications.
Is there a deadline for submitting the pre-qualification form?
While specific deadlines may depend on individual projects, it’s best to submit the form as early as possible to ensure evaluations are completed on time.
What is the submission method for this form?
Forms can be submitted directly through pdfFiller or printed and sent via email or traditional mail, depending on the requirements of the evaluating company.
What documentation do I need to support my application?
You should have documentation ready, such as proof of insurance, bonding information, company references, and details of previous projects completed.
What common errors should I av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all fields are filled accurately, avoid leaving checkboxes unchecked, and review for any data entry errors before submission.
How long does the approval process typically take after submitting the form?
Processing times can vary, but expect several days to weeks based on the company's review practices and volume of applications.
What if I need to make changes after submitting the form?
If changes are needed post-submission, contact the evaluating company directly to find out the procedure for amending your submitted form.
